You may file your Maryland Corporation or Pass-Through Entity returns electronically using the Modernized e-File method of Federal/State 1120/1065 filing. For more information, contact our e-File Help Desk at 410-260-7753

You can file your Maryland employer withholding tax returns (Form MW506) and sales and use tax returns for free online, using bFile, if you meet the requirements below. The service applies to filing periods in the current year and two back years.

You may use bFile to file employer withholding, sales and use tax, and withholding reconciliation returns. Do not send a paper form if you file using bFile.

To use bFile, you need to have:

  • a valid federal employer identification number (FEIN) or Social Security number, AND
  • a Maryland Central Registration Number (your eight-digit Maryland tax account number).
If you have not registered to file Maryland business taxes or do not have a Maryland Central Registration Number, you may register by completing the Maryland Combined Registration Online Application. You will receive the necessary information to file Maryland business taxes approximately one week after submitting your application online.

For system requirements, see bFile Online Service Center General Help

You can also file the following business returns electronically through approved Maryland Online bFile Providers:
  • Sales and use tax returns
  • Employer withholding returns
  • Wage and tax statements (Form W-2)
  • Unemployment insurance reports (Form Maryland Department of Labor/OUI 15/16)
